GitHub Stars Curator

An agent skill (Codex, Claude Code, and other SKILL.md-compatible agents) that organizes the GitHub repositories you starred into stable, clear, long-term-maintainable lists.

Features

  • Inventory refresh — fetch the full starred-repo inventory and compute a delta (newStars / removedStars) against the previous snapshot.
  • README corpus — download every repo's README into a local semantic review corpus with per-repo metadata stubs.
  • Classification — an agent reads the READMEs (not just descriptions) and assigns repos to a reusable taxonomy; scripted recording with list-name validation.
  • General-purpose taxonomy — a bundled 23-bucket taxonomy (personal software, AI/agent tooling, self-hosted services, developer infrastructure, and a fallback), extendable per workspace. A 500-repo probe and a 300-repo random sample both confirm ~90%+ reasonable placement of classifiable repos.
  • Bucket overload review — when a bucket exceeds ~10% of the total star count (floor 30), the agent analyzes its contents, proposes concrete splits, and asks before creating new lists (recorded in the workspace taxonomy only).
  • Cloud drift audit — read live GitHub list memberships before any writeback; deliberate live edits win, accidental ones are corrected to the ledger's intent at apply.
  • Safe writeback — offline plan → online plan (review planHash) → apply with an approved plan; unmanaged lists are preserved by default, and deleting any list requires explicit user approval.

Scripts

  • fetch_star_inventory.py — fetch stars and compute the delta (github-stars.json, github-stars-delta.json, github-stars-summary.json).
  • fetch_readmes.py — download READMEs into star-readmes/raw/ and merge per-repo metadata stubs.
  • split_manifest.py — split the inventory into balanced batches for parallel subagent classification.
  • merge_classifications.py — validate and merge per-batch classification results (JSON-integrity, 1:1 coverage, list-name whitelist, cross-batch duplicates).
  • write_classification.py — record agent classifications into meta files and emit a ledger; validates list names against the taxonomy; --merge-into-full merges a narrow ledger back into the full record with a snapshot, and --prune-removed drops unstarred repos from it.
  • reclassify_bucket.py — apply an adopted bucket split from a {repo: [new lists]} mapping through the same validation and snapshot-and-merge path as write_classification.py --merge-into-full.
  • init_taxonomy.py — copy the bundled taxonomy template to <workspace>/taxonomy.yaml (refuses to overwrite an existing workspace copy).
  • audit_cloud_drift.py — read-only live-vs-ledger drift audit before writeback; exit code 0 = no drift or only expected pre-sync localNotLive drift, non-zero = liveNotLocal reconcile signal.
  • apply_user_lists.py — offline plan / online plan / apply (creates missing lists in taxonomy order, updates descriptions and memberships, writes an audit journal); --retry N retries transient network errors per mutation.

Taxonomy

The bundled references/taxonomy-template.yaml defines 23 buckets: downloaders, cloud-drive-transfer-sync, clipboard-tools, media-players, agent-tools, ai-agents, dev-tools, terminal, windows-tools, desktop-apps, reading-notes, pdf-document-tools, references-guides, self-hosted, cloudflare-network-proxy, frameworks-libraries, data-ml-tools, game-3d-creative, design-assets, business-apps, web-scraping-data-collection, security-pentest-tools, everything-else.

A workspace can extend it by copying the template to <workspace>/taxonomy.yaml and adding lists there (e.g. video-downloaders, agent-skills were added this way after a bucket overload review). The 32-list GitHub cap is enforced at plan time.

Safety model

  • Plan, review, then mutate. Every writeback goes through offline plan → online plan (review planHash) → apply with --approved-plan; a tampered or stale plan is refused.
  • Deliberate live edits win; accidents don't. Cloud drift is checked proactively before writeback; deliberate manual cloud edits are preserved (local ledgers never silently overwrite them), while an accidental cloud edit (repo in the wrong list) is corrected back to the ledger's intent at apply.
  • Unmanaged lists are preserved by default. Lists outside the loaded taxonomy are left alone; when they are discovered, the user is asked whether to delete them, and deletion happens only with explicit approval.
  • Unexpected removals stop the flow. Any listsToRemove outside the current request is a pause-and-review signal.
  • Human checkpoints. Bucket overload, taxonomy drift, single-repo new lists, and auth gaps all pause for review.
